PBS Space Time season 2016 episode 18 is titled "Will Starshot's Interstellar Journey Succeed?" This episode delves into the quest of the Starshot mission, which aims to send a fleet of tiny spacecraft to Alpha Centauri, the nearest star system to our own, in order to search for signs of life.

The episode starts with an overview of the current limitations of space travel, highlighting the challenges posed by the vast distances between stars and the high speeds required to make meaningful progress. The episode then introduces the concept of the Starshot mission, which seeks to overcome these limitations by using a swarm of small spacecraft equipped with ultra-light sails that can be propelled by high-energy laser beams.

The episode explores the science behind the Starshot mission, explaining the mechanics of propulsion and how lasers can provide the necessary power to propel the spacecraft to near-relativistic speeds. The episode also highlights some of the technical challenges that must be overcome in order for the mission to be successful, including developing a functional laser array with enough energy to propel the spacecraft, designing a navigation system that can accurately guide the tiny probes to their target, and creating materials that can withstand the extreme conditions encountered during the journey.

Throughout the episode, the PBS Space Time team speaks with experts in the field of space exploration and astrophysics, including scientists involved in the development of the Starshot mission. These experts provide insight into the scientific principles underlying the mission, as well as the challenges and potential benefits of the project.

The episode also takes a look at the potential impact of the Starshot mission on our understanding of the universe and the prospects for discovering extraterrestrial life. It explores the current search for exoplanets, explaining the methods used to identify these distant worlds and the data that can be gleaned about their composition and potential habitability. The episode notes that the Starshot mission could potentially revolutionize this search, providing the means to collect data about planets around Alpha Centauri in unprecedented detail.
